| | |
| | | <el-divider/> |
| | | |
| | | <h3 class="drawer-title">系统布局配置</h3> |
| | | |
| | | |
| | | <div class="drawer-item"> |
| | | <span>开启 TopNav</span> |
| | | <el-switch v-model="topNav" class="drawer-switch" /> |
| | |
| | | value: val |
| | | }) |
| | | if (!val) { |
| | | this.$store.dispatch('app/toggleSideBarHide', false); |
| | | this.$store.commit("SET_SIDEBAR_ROUTERS", this.$store.state.permission.defaultRoutes); |
| | | } |
| | | } |
| | |
| | | this.sideTheme = val; |
| | | }, |
| | | saveSetting() { |
| | | this.$modal.loading("正在保存到本地,请稍后..."); |
| | | this.$modal.loading("正在保存到本地,请稍候..."); |
| | | this.$cache.local.set( |
| | | "layout-setting", |
| | | `{ |
| | |
| | | setTimeout(this.$modal.closeLoading(), 1000) |
| | | }, |
| | | resetSetting() { |
| | | this.$modal.loading("正在清除设置缓存并刷新,请稍后..."); |
| | | this.$modal.loading("正在清除设置缓存并刷新,请稍候..."); |
| | | this.$cache.local.remove("layout-setting") |
| | | setTimeout("window.location.reload()", 1000) |
| | | } |